Ingredients


– 1 bunch fresh radishes, finely diced
– 1 medium red onion, diced
– 1-2 jalapeño peppers, seeds removed and finely chopped
– 1 cup fresh cilantro, chopped
– 1-2 limes, juiced
– Salt and pepper, to taste
– Optional: 1-2 roma tomatoes, diced

Step-by-Step Instructions


Creating Fresh Radish Salsa is straightforward if you follow these simple steps:
1. Prepare the Radishes: Rinse the radishes under cool water, trim the ends, and finely dice them.
2. Dice the Onion: Peel and finely dice the red onion. Aim for small, uniform pieces for even flavor distribution.
3. Chop the Jalapeños: Carefully slice the jalapeños in half, remove the seeds (for less heat), and finely chop them.
4. Finely Chop Cilantro: Rinse the cilantro and chop it finely, ensuring there are no large leaves.
5. Combine Ingredients: In a large mixing bowl, combine the diced radishes, onion, jalapeños, and cilantro.
6. Add Lime Juice: Squeeze the juice from 1-2 limes into the mixture, adjusting to your taste preference.
7. Season: Add salt and pepper to taste, mixing well to combine all the flavors.
8. Optional Tomatoes: If using, add the diced roma tomatoes and gently mix them in.
9. Chill: Cover the bowl with plastic wrap and refrigerate the salsa for 15-30 minutes to allow the flavors to meld.
10. Serve: Enjoy your Fresh Radish Salsa with tortilla chips, tacos, grilled meats, or as a refreshing salad topping!

Additional Tips


Use Fresh Ingredients: To achieve the best flavor, use the freshest radishes, cilantro, and lime.
Experiment with Heat: Adjust the number of jalapeños to suit your heat preference. For less spice, remove all seeds.
Chill for Better Flavor: Letting the salsa chill for at least 30 minutes allows the flavors to meld wonderfully.
Add Avocado: For a creamier texture, consider adding diced avocado to your salsa just before serving.

Recipe Variation


Feel free to explore different flavors! Here are a few variations you might enjoy:
1. Fruit Salsa: Incorporate some diced mango or pineapple for a fruity twist.
2. Corn Addition: Add some sweet corn for a delightful crunch and sweetness.
3. Herb Swaps: Substitute cilantro with fresh parsley or mint for a completely different herbaceous note.

Freezing and Storage


Storage: Keep Fresh Radish Salsa in an airtight container in the refrigerator. It can last up to 3 days.
Freezing: While fresh salsa is best enjoyed immediately, you can freeze it. Use a freezer-safe container and it should maintain quality for up to a month.

Frequently Asked Questions


Can I use other types of radishes?
Yes, while this recipe calls for standard radishes, you can also experiment with colorful varieties like watermelon or black radishes for unique flavors.
How spicy is this salsa?
The spiciness can vary based on the jalapeños you select. Start with one pepper and taste as you go.
Can I make this salsa a day in advance?
Absolutely! Preparing it the day before can enhance the flavors as they have more time to meld.
What can I substitute if I don’t have lime?
Lemon juice is a great alternative if you don’t have lime on hand.
Is this recipe vegan?
Yes, Fresh Radish Salsa is entirely plant-based and perfect for vegan diets.
